From farm to table trip:
Wake up and enjoy a organic and natural breakfast at Windward House. Walk over to the Farmer’s Market at the Knox Mill on Washington Street, downtown Camden Maine and see local vegetables, flowers, jams and crafts. Then hop on you rented bicyle and head out on the “Most Beautiful Walk” route through Camden and Rockport. You will pass by Aldermere Farm where you will see the famous Belted Galloway cows. You might want to stop at Laite Beach to get your feet wet and cool down. If need more of a workout, bike up to the Camden Dalhia Farm and enjoy the flowers. Then back Windward House were you can enjoy a locally made wine and prepare for dinner at Primo in Owls Head Maine. By far the best organic restaurant in MidCoast Maine. Go early so you can walk around the grounds and see the gardens. If you can not get into Primo we suggest trying Shepard’s Pie in Rockport.
